PSG changes its tune for Milan Škriniar

What’s next after this ad

New twist in the Milan Škriniar case (27 years old). In recent hours, we revealed to you exclusively that an English club had interfered in the tumultuous case leading to the central defender of Inter Milan, whose contract will expire on June 30 in Lombardy. The interesting contractual situation of the Slovak international (54 caps, 3 goals) logically stirs up envy. Especially since his agent has confirmed that he will not extend his stay in Milan.

Courted by Paris Saint-Germain last summer, Milan Škriniar will remain associated with the capital club this winter. If the reigning French champions were not necessarily very keen on the idea of ​​​​moving their pawns in January, Inter claiming between 15 and 20 M€ to let him slip away 6 months from the end of his contract, and that Christophe Galtier has not publicly announced his need to see a defensive element land this winter, things are taking a very different turn.

Nasser al-Khelaïfi takes matters into his own hands

According to our information, Nasser al-Khalaïfi himself has taken matters into his own hands in the Milan Škriniar case. The president of Paris SG is now determined to attract the Slovak in his nets by the end of the winter transfer window 2023, on January 31. The position of the Rouge et Bleu is now clear: the objective is to recruit the experienced player from Inter, who will celebrate his 28th birthday on February 11th. It remains to be seen under what conditions this deal will be made, if NAK goes to the end of things in the coming days, while Škriniar was asking for a salary of €9 million net in Paris.

The PSG boss is in any case determined to beat the competition from the English team in this story. Initially expected next summer, Milan Škriniar could therefore well come to strengthen the central defense of PSG this winter, while a very busy schedule and important deadlines await the men of Christophe Galtier. In the meantime, Nasser al-Khalaïfi should experience a very hectic end to the transfer window.
